Full Job Description
ABOUT THE ROLE:
The Project Manager plays a critical role in driving cross-functional initiatives that support Skechers' continued growth and operational excellence. This individual will be responsible for planning, executing, and delivering projects on time, within scope, and on budget across multiple departments. Working closely with stakeholders in product, technology, marketing, and operations, the Project Manager ensures alignment and clear communication throughout the project lifecycle. This role offers the opportunity to lead high-impact projects that directly contribute to the innovation and efficiency of a globally recognized lifestyle brand.

WHAT YOU WILL DO:

  • Lead end-to-end project management for cross-functional initiatives, including defining project scope, goals, deliverables, timelines, and success metrics.
  • Develop and maintain detailed project plans, schedules, and status reports to keep stakeholders informed and projects on track.
  • Facilitate project meetings, workshops, and reviews, ensuring clear communication and accountability across all teams.
  • Identify, assess, and mitigate project risks and issues, escalating to leadership as appropriate to minimize impact on delivery.
  • Manage relationships with internal stakeholders and external vendors, ensuring resource availability and alignment with business priorities.
  • Drive continuous process improvement by implementing project management best practices, tools, and methodologies (Agile, AI, ETC).
  • Track and report on project KPIs and budgets, providing regular updates to senior leadership and department heads.

WHAT WE NEED FROM YOU:

  • Required: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Management, or a related field.
  • Required: 3–5 years of proven project management experience, preferably in a retail, consumer goods, or technology environment.
  • Required: Strong proficiency in project management tools such as Asana, Jira, Microsoft Project, or Smartsheet.
  • Required: Excellent communication, organization, and stakeholder management sk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Preferred: PMP (Project Management Professional) or CAPM certification.
  • Preferred: Experience working in a fast-paced, global organization.
  • Preferred: Familiarity with Agile/Scrum methodologies.

The pay range for this position is $95,000-$125,000/yr USD.

About Skechers USA, Inc

SKECHERS USA, Inc. designs, develops and markets more than 3,000 styles for men, women and children. SKECHERS' success stems from its employees, high-quality, varied product offering, diversified domestic and international distribution channels, and targeted multi-channel marketing.
